IP查询
查询
你查询的IP:[120.24.59.52] 地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)
最新查询
119.16.65.59
202.70.213.150
119.32.17.86
210.72.74.4
118.228.101.81
118.248.212.42
122.119.241.51
120.32.11.107
123.242.132.241
120.24.59.52
119.235.128.246
60.245.128.172
123.99.128.171
219.82.97.99
123.242.51.12
210.16.128.207
222.64.63.39
121.32.255.70
60.208.204.48
119.28.166.68
202.125.176.67
116.212.160.14
119.2.128.108
117.122.128.195
60.208.78.76
123.128.203.143
116.16.191.155
203.222.192.250
220.192.60.3
122.204.73.162
122.48.44.203